Rock Climbing / Rappelling

picture

Since State College is so mountainous, you have your pick as to where you would like to rock climb or rappel. One such location is in Donation, PA. Take PA 26 east toward Pine Grove Mills. Go over the mountain and follow until you get to a stop sign at McAlevy's Fort. At the stop sign you turn right (bearing left will take you out to Greenwood Furnace State Park). Follow PA 26 through McAlevy' s Fort. As long as you stay on PA 26, you will get to the Village of Donation. After passing through, there is a small church on the right. Make a right there and follow until you get to an elk farm. At the farm turn left and follow the road through the gap in the ridge. There may even be some anchors already there for you to use. This is on private property so you need to contact the PSU Outing Club: http://www.clubs.psu.edu/outing

Here are some other places to go if you want to get away from it all...

Panther Rocks
Directions: From Anderson Creek (N of I-80, Exit 18), drive 3 miles East on Four Mile Rd. Panther Rocks are on the right
Level: Beginner

Huntingdon Rocks
Directions: Huntingdon Rocks are in Huntingdon above Juniata River & railroad tracks. Ask locals. Please don't trespass.
Level: Advanced

Coburn Area
Directions: from Coburn (S of Hwy 45), cross bridge in town over Penns Creek. Follow road to rock on right. Coburn Rocks at roadside and above.
Level: Mixed beginner and advanced

Pinnacle Rock in the Coburn Area
Directions: Go 1 mile South of Coburn Rock. Park and cross RR trestle. Hike on path to left for Pinnacle Rock.

PSU Campus
Directions: Hammond Wall (90' traverse), The Obelisk (L of Old Main).
Level: Mixed grades

Double Secret Quarry
Directions: from Bellefonte, go south on Hwy 150 to Pleasant Gap. Follow Hwy 155 east to a right turn onto White Rock Rd. Follow this to the end. Walk path past gate and along farmer field to Pleasant Gap Quarries 150 yards from road.
Level: Intermediate

Castanea Slab Directions: At Castanea (S of Lock Haven), Castanea Slab is on Hwy 220.
Level: Intermediate

Big Rocks
Directions: Fr Snowshoe (I-80 at Exit 22), drive W on Hwy 53. Turn N on Hwy 144 for ~30 mi. Turn left at Barney's Ridge Rd and follow to Big Rock's Vista Rd. Turn right and follow to Big Rocks on left.
Level: Intermediate/Expert
